javaScript
자바스크립트 기초(2)_alert/prompt/confirm
밍블리-셔
2024. 12. 31. 15:35
alert() : 알려줌 - 메세지를 띄우고 확인 버튼을 누르기 전까지 계속 띄워져 있음
prompt() : 입력 받음 - 입력 필드 제공
confirm() : 확인 받음 - true / false 값 반환
alert 활용
const name = prompt("이름을 입력하세요.");
//alert("환영합니다, " + name + "님");
alert(`안녕하세요, ${name}님. 환영합니다.`); //위 코드 백틱으로 변환
console.log(name)
prompt 활용
//prompt는 두개의 인수를 받을 수 있음.
//인수란 함수를 실행하는 과정에서 들어가는 값
const name2 = prompt("예약일을 입력해주세요.", "2020-10-"); //두번째 인수는 입력받을 default 값
confirm 활용
const isAdult = confirm("당신은 성인 입니까?"); // 취소(false) or 확인(true)
console.log(isAdult);
단점
1. 상자가 떠있는 동안 스크립트가 일시 정지 된다.
2. 스타일링이 어렵다(스타일링 하려면 이런 기본 메서드가 아닌 모달창으로 구현하고 기능 넣어야됨)